With a population of 1.60 million, Manaus is the largest city in Amazonas, Brazil by the number of inhabitants. It is one of the most popular cities to visit in the country. We recommend you stay at least 3 days in order to fully appreciate everything Manaus has to offer.
Looking for warm weather? Then head to Manaus in January, when the average temperature is 82.4 °F, and the highest can go up to 91.4 °F. The coldest month, on the other hand, is June, when it can get as cold as 71.6 °F, with an average temperature of 78.8 °F. You’re likely to see more rain in June, when precipitation is around 14.2″. In contrast, January is usually the driest month of the year in Manaus, with an average rainfall of 0.8″.
When flying to Manaus, you’ll arrive at Manaus Eduardo Gomes Intl (MAO), which is located 6 miles from the city center. The shortest flight to Manaus from the United States departs from Miami and takes around 5h 55m.
You can travel by bus to Manaus using Bus or Viação Eucatur. From Boa Vista, the bus ride to Manaus takes 745 miles and will cost you around $29. From Porto Velho, the ticket costs about $171 for a journey of 1495 miles. Manaus’s bus station is located 3 miles from the city center.
